Description

D-Glucitol-2-D CAS NO 75607-68-0 is a deuterated derivative of D-glucitol (sorbitol), where a hydrogen atom at the 2-position is replaced by deuterium, a stable isotope of hydrogen. This isotopic labeling makes it a crucial tool in advanced research and analytical chemistry, particularly for use as an internal standard in mass spectrometry and NMR spectroscopy. It is essential for scientists and manufacturers in the pharmaceutical, biotechnology, and analytical reagent sectors who require precise metabolic pathway tracing, pharmacokinetic studies, and high-accuracy quantitative analysis.

Application

  • Internal Standard for Mass Spectrometry (MS): Used for the accurate quantification of sorbitol and related metabolites in complex biological matrices like blood, urine, and tissue samples.
  • Nuclear Magnetic Resonance (NMR) Spectroscopy: Serves as a deuterated tracer in metabolic flux analysis and mechanistic studies of biochemical pathways.
  • Pharmaceutical Research & Development: Critical in drug metabolism and pharmacokinetics (DMPK) studies to track the fate of drug molecules and excipients.
  • Biochemical Research: Employed in enzymatic studies and investigations of the polyol pathway, which is significant in diabetes research.
  • Stable Isotope Labeling: Used in the synthesis of more complex deuterated compounds for research purposes.
  • Quality Control in Analytical Laboratories: Ensures method validation and accuracy in high-performance liquid chromatography (HPLC) and LC-MS/MS systems.

Basic Information

Product Name D-Glucitol-2-D
CAS No. 75607-68-0
Molecular Formula C6H13DO6
Molecular Weight 183.17 g/mol
Synonyms D-Sorbitol-2-d; (2R)-1-Deoxy-1-(2H)deuterio-D-glucitol; 2-Deuterio-D-glucitol; Sorbitol-2-d; D-Glucitol-2-d1; 2-Deuterosorbitol; Isotopically Labeled Sorbitol; Hexitol-2-d

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ive); therefore, the container must be kept tightly sealed in a dry environment to prevent absorption of water vapor, which can affect stability and analytical performance.
